Coexistence of Prader-Willi syndrome, congenital ectropion uveae with glaucoma, and factor XI deficiency.

W Futterweit, R Ritch, C Teekhasaenee, E S Nelson.   

Abstract

A patient with Prader-Willi syndrome and unilateral congenital ectropion uveae with glaucoma was found to have factor XI deficiency and reduced levels of serum luteinizing hormone, follicle-stimulating hormone, and testosterone. Administration of gonadorelin (LH-RH) increased serum levels of luteinizing hormone and follicle-stimulating hormone, while clomiphene citrate had no effect, suggesting a primary hypothalamic defect. Patients with congenital ectropion uveae should be followed up for the development of both glaucoma and neural crest disorders.
